Ruth van Beek has been collecting photographs from all over the place for years. Newspaper clippings, amateur family pictures, images from old books and the internet. She puts them together in an ever-growing archive. The archive is chaotic and fluent. Subjects range from family life, landscape, archeological findings, natural disasters, spectacular findings, flower arrangement and handcraft instructions. The Hibernators are an animal species made from pictures of small common pets. Cats, guinea pigs, rabbits and dogs. The kind you find in many homes and that are beloved and pampered by their owners. Animals in the photos are brought back to life by cutting and folding the paper. Instead of being released, they are restrained once more in a new shape. This way they become creatures that are silent like stones, but that also show a tension. The moment before awaking. They want to move, they have tasted freedom!
